We are seeking a skilled SQL Server DBA to join our dynamic team and help us manage and optimize our database systems.

The SQL Server Database Administrator will be responsible for the installation, configuration, maintenance, and performance tuning of SQL Server databases. The ideal candidate will ensure the availability and consistent performance of our applications and databases. This role requires deep SQL Server database knowledge, strong communication and problem-solving skills, and attention to detail. The candidate will have a continuous improvement mindset, with the desire to automate processes and reduce manual effort wherever possible.

Database Experience:

Installation and Configuration: Install and configure SQL Server databases to meet business requirements.

Performance Monitoring: Monitor system performance and identify potential issues.

Optimization: Perform database tuning using T-SQL and optimize queries.

Security Management: Implement and manage database security measures to protect sensitive data.

Backup and Recovery: Conduct regular backups and ensure reliable recovery processes.

High Availability: Manage SQL AlwaysOn configurations.

Change Tracking: Implement and manage Change Tracking and Change Data Capture.

Integration Services: Familiarity with SSIS, SSRS, and SSAS.

Scripting: Utilize PowerShell or other scripting languages (a plus).

Additional Database Knowledge: Knowledge of Oracle and Postgres (a plus).

Key Responsibilities:

Capacity Planning: Conduct database capacity planning to ensure scalability.

Collaboration: Work closely with development teams to design and implement effective database solutions.

Monitoring and Tuning: Use DPA for database monitoring and SQL tuning.

On-Call Support: Provide 24x7 on-call rotation support for critical production systems.

Releases: Manage application and infrastructure releases.

Documentation: Develop and maintain comprehensive documentation for database processes.

Backup Strategies: Implement backup and recovery strategies using native and third-party tools (e.g., Cohesity).

Virtual Environment: Create and manage new database servers in a virtual environment (VMWare).

Server Migrations: Perform server migrations as needed.

Cloud Support: Support SQL databases in public cloud environments (Azure and AWS).
